He doesn’t use a magnifying glass, doesn’t wear a long beige coat, or solve mysterious crimes on the spot. But he knows the hours and hours of hiding, of shadowing, to catch a precious shot. At 43, Maël is a private detective – also called a private research agent. A profession that he has been practicing for almost ten years, whose independence and variety he praises, but which is far removed from the preconceived ideas permeating the collective imagination. “Our job is not at all what you see in a novel or in a series,” warns the professional.

Even if it looks nothing like Adrian Monk, Sherlock Holmes or Veronica Mars, the profession of private detective is vast, explains Maël, manager of the company “In the service of proof”. He can work on behalf of an individual, on “requests to search for adultery” as part of proceedings for faulty divorce, for example. In separation cases, “we may need a detective for issues of custody rights, children, alimony”.
